Web10 iun. 2024 · Whether a language is high-level or low-level has to do with abstraction, and how close to the operating system the language works. Low-level languages are closer to the computer system. One of the most common low-level languages is machine code. WebC is considered a “mid-level” language. It is not as low-level as assembly languages. But It is more low-level than most of the popular high-level languages like Python or JavaScript. C can be used for both systems and application development because of its flexibility, efficiency, and wide support by hardware manufacturers. 4.
